Independent Testing and Certification of Game Providers
Independent testing and certification of game providers are crucial for ensuring game fairness in the ever-evolving gaming market. Certified providers adhere to strict industry standards, which cover everything from RNG systems to the accuracy of game rules. Independent organizations conduct compliance audits, verifying that games operate as intended and that players receive transparent payout information.
For instance, organizations like eCOGRA and iTech Labs are known for their rigorous testing processes. They assess not only the gameplay mechanics but also the integrity of the random number generators used. This level of scrutiny helps foster player trust, ensuring that outcomes are fair and unpredictable, which is vital for enhancing the overall gaming experience.
